About This Venue
Black Husky Brewing is a dog-friendly craft brewery in Milwaukee's Riverwest neighborhood that honors its unique heritage with quality beers and a welcoming community atmosphere.
Founded in 2010 in rural Pembine, Wisconsin, Black Husky Brewing was inspired by the owner's sled dog kennel and named after their beloved husky, Howler. The brewery relocated to its current Milwaukee location in 2016, maintaining the same dedication to craft beer production while expanding its reach. Today, the taproom at 909 E. Locust St. features 12 rotating beers on tap, flights, canned selections to-go, and an expanding spirits and wine menu, all produced with the same care that defined the brewery's origins.
The taproom creates an inclusive, laid-back vibe perfect for both beer enthusiasts and casual visitors, with well-behaved leashed dogs welcome alongside their owners. Beyond sampling craft beers, guests can enjoy regular events ranging from "Milwaukee's Worst Trivia" on Tuesdays to strongman competitions and special beer releases, making Black Husky a hub for community gathering and entertainment in the Riverwest area.
